A critical component in emergency safety equipment, this device blends hot and cold water to provide a tepid water supply for rinsing the eyes. The result is a temperature-controlled flow of water, crucial for effectively flushing contaminants without causing further injury. An example application includes industrial facilities where exposure to chemicals or particulate matter poses a risk to workers’ eyesight.

The implementation of this temperature regulation technology is vital for several reasons. Delivering water within a specific temperature range (typically between 60F and 100F) prevents scalding or hypothermia, which could exacerbate the initial eye injury. Furthermore, tepid water encourages longer rinsing times, leading to more effective removal of hazardous substances. The development of such systems reflects an increasing emphasis on workplace safety standards and the mitigation of potential harm during emergency situations.

A crucial component in low-pressure chemical application systems, this device precisely regulates the flow rate of cleaning solutions. For instance, in exterior cleaning, it allows for the accurate dilution of detergents and sanitizers, ensuring optimal cleaning performance and minimizing chemical waste. This control is vital for achieving desired results without damaging surfaces or posing environmental risks.

Its importance stems from its ability to enhance the efficiency and effectiveness of cleaning processes. By delivering consistent and metered amounts of chemicals, it reduces reliance on guesswork and human error, leading to more predictable outcomes. Historically, less sophisticated methods resulted in inconsistent cleaning and potential damage; this technology represents a significant advancement in achieving uniform and controlled chemical applications.

The component in question is a critical assembly within the 68RFE automatic transmission. It serves as the hydraulic control center, directing pressurized transmission fluid to various clutches and servos to facilitate gear changes. Malfunctions within this unit can lead to erratic shifting, transmission slippage, or complete failure.

Functionality is paramount to the overall performance and longevity of the transmission. Proper operation ensures smooth gear transitions, optimal fuel economy, and reduced wear and tear on internal components. Its design reflects advancements in transmission technology, aiming to improve shift quality and reliability compared to earlier automatic transmissions.

A plumbing component constructed from polyvinyl chloride (PVC) designed with two ports to control fluid flow. This particular apparatus allows for either opening or closing a pathway, thereby regulating the passage of liquids or gases within a piping system. As an illustration, it can be used to direct water flow to one area of a sprinkler system or to shut off water supply to a specific section for maintenance.

This type of control device is frequently employed in irrigation, plumbing, and chemical processing applications due to its resistance to corrosion, durability, and cost-effectiveness. Its implementation offers significant advantages, including precise flow management, ease of installation, and a prolonged lifespan compared to metallic alternatives. Historically, the development of PVC materials has enabled the production of robust and economical fluid control solutions in various industrial and residential settings.

A device used to blend or divert fluids, often liquids, by combining flows from two inlets into a single outlet, or conversely, diverting a single inlet flow into two outlets. These devices typically have three ports and internally utilize a rotary or linear mechanism to control the proportions of the different fluid streams that are mixed or directed. An example is in hydronic heating systems where it regulates water temperature supplied to radiators or underfloor heating by blending hot water from a boiler with cooler return water.

These specialized valves play a crucial role in optimizing energy efficiency, maintaining precise temperature control, and protecting equipment from thermal shock. Their adoption has increased steadily over the years as industries seek better methods for managing fluid temperatures in process control, HVAC, and other applications. The use of these systems contributes significantly to reduced energy consumption and improved overall system performance.

The defined measurements specifying the rotational force to apply to fasteners on the hydraulic control unit of a specific six-speed automatic transmission (6L80) are critical. These values, typically expressed in Newton-meters (Nm) or pound-inches (lb-in), ensure proper sealing and component retention within the transmission. Failure to adhere to these defined measurements can lead to leaks, internal damage, and compromised transmission performance. For example, under-torquing bolts may not provide a sufficient seal, leading to fluid loss, while over-torquing can damage threads or distort the valve body itself.

Accurate fastening is paramount for proper function and longevity of the automatic transmission. It directly affects the reliability and operational integrity of the shifting mechanism. Historically, improper assembly practices contributed significantly to transmission failures; adherence to specified fastening guidelines mitigates these risks. The implementation of precise fastening protocols also contributes to consistent and predictable performance across rebuilds and repairs.

Devices that facilitate the reduction of tire pressure by enabling controlled release of air from the tire are critical components in off-road driving. These devices typically replace or attach to the standard component responsible for inflation and deflation, allowing users to lower pressure to a desired level without fully removing the core. Examples of such devices range from simple threaded tools to more complex, automated systems.

Lowering tire pressure increases the contact area between the tire and the terrain, significantly enhancing traction on surfaces such as sand, mud, and rocks. This increased traction translates to improved vehicle performance and reduced risk of getting stuck. Furthermore, decreased pressure provides a more comfortable ride by absorbing bumps and vibrations, and it can also minimize potential damage to tires and the vehicle’s suspension system. The practice of decreasing pressure has a long history within off-road communities, evolving alongside the development of off-road vehicles and tires.

A diverting mechanism constructed from polyvinyl chloride (PVC) that uses a spherical closure to control the flow of fluid through three separate ports represents a versatile plumbing component. Rotation of an internal ball with a bore through it dictates which ports are connected, allowing for fluid to be directed to different destinations or to be shut off completely. An example application involves directing water from a single source to either a pool filter or a bypass line, based on operational needs.

These valves offer a cost-effective and durable solution for fluid control, particularly in applications where corrosion resistance is paramount. Their widespread adoption stems from the ease of installation, relatively low maintenance requirements, and ability to withstand various chemicals. Historically, these valves have replaced metallic alternatives in many applications due to the reduced cost and improved resistance to degradation from corrosive substances, contributing to longer service life and reduced operational expenses.

This crucial component within a pneumatic braking system is designed to safeguard against over-pressurization. Functioning as a safety mechanism, it automatically discharges excess compressed air when the system pressure surpasses a predetermined threshold. For instance, if a compressor malfunction leads to an uncontrolled pressure increase, this device activates to vent the surplus air, preventing potential damage to the braking system’s components.

The incorporation of such a mechanism is paramount to maintaining the operational integrity and reliability of pneumatic brakes. It mitigates the risk of component failure due to excessive pressure, contributing significantly to enhanced safety during vehicle operation. Historically, these have evolved from simple spring-loaded designs to more sophisticated, precisely calibrated units, reflecting advancements in braking technology and stringent safety standards.
